Eulogy: Josephine Tewson Death Cause Linked With Growing Age Her representative uncovered that Josephine Tewson, who featured in the TV programs “Keeping Up Appearances” and “Last of the Summer Wine,” died at 91.

Additionally, since she is professed to have died calmly while dozing, her reason for death might have been connected with her more seasoned age.

On Thursday night at Denville Hall, the British sitcom entertainer died “calmly.”

“It is with colossal pity that I can affirm Josephine Tewson’s passing,” expressed her representative Jean Diamond of Diamond Management. “Josephine, 91, died calmly the previous evening at Denville Hall.”

Her cutting edge execution came in the 1979 film Shelley as Edna “Mrs. H” Hawkins. She showed up in six times of the Peter Tilbury-composed and delivered sitcom that broadcasted during the 1980s and mid 1990s.

Extra jobs included repeating appearances close by comedic legends Ronnie Corbett and Ronnie Barker on David Frost on Sunday, Gark at Barker, police dramatization Z-Cars, and The Charlie Drake Show.

Before she resigned, her last undertaking was a 1988 appearance on Clarence with Barker.

In the loved BBC sitcom Keeping Up Appearances, she was generally perceived for her job as the practical Elizabeth Warden, Hyacinth’s neighbor, and hesitant compatriot.

Two times Married Tweson’s Second Husband Henry Newman Died In 1980 The noticeable entertainer was hitched two times in the course of her life. She was first hitched to her significant other, Rising Damp entertainer Leonard Rossiter, in 1958.

In any case, their marriage didn’t keep going long as, after just three years of marriage, they got separated in 1961.

For north of 10 years, the entertainer remained single and held on until she again tracked down affection with Henry Newman, her subsequent spouse. The couple allegedly marry in 1972, and as per reports, they were hitched for a very long time before his shocking destruction in 1980.

Hitched For 8 Years To Late Husband Henry But Had No Kids In spite of the fact that Tewson was hitched two times, she had no children from both of her spouses. She was hitched for quite some time to her subsequent spouse, Henry, however they are accounted for to have had no youngsters.

Be that as it may, in contrast to Tweson, her ex, Leonard, was the dad of a girl. Rossiter began living with entertainer Gillian Raine two years after their separation since they experienced passionate feelings for during the play’s second run at the Belgrade.

The couple had a girl named Camilla, and they formally traded promises in 1972, that very year, Tweson wedded Henry.

Rossiter and his significant other stayed together until his demise on October 5, 1984.
